Reinhard Gruber is Professor of Oral Biology at the University Clinic of Dentistry, Medical University of Vienna, Austria. A leader in regenerative dentistry, he received his doctorate from the University of Natural Resources and Life Sciences in Vienna and joined the Medical University of Vienna in 1999 following a postdoctoral appointment in Rheumatology. His academic career includes visiting scholar positions at Carnegie Mellon University and the University of Michigan, as well as leadership of the Laboratory of Oral Cell Biology at the University of Bern. His research integrates fundamental cell biology, preclinical models, and clinical studies to advance causal therapeutic strategies in regenerative dentistry. He is a former board member of the Osteology Foundation and served on the ITI Research Committee. He is associate editor of Clinical Oral Implants Research and the Journal of Periodontal Research, and was formerly associate editor of The International Journal of Oral & Maxillofacial Implants.
